Recent Showdown: Pistons vs Celtics (Nov 26, 2025)

The most recent Detroit Pistons vs Celtics game ended with a dramatic 117-114 win for Boston.

  • The Celtics snapped Detroit’s 13-game winning streak, a franchise record-tying run for the Pistons.

  • For Detroit, star guard Cade Cunningham exploded for 42 points, yet missed the game-tying free throw with seconds remaining.

  • Boston was paced by Derrick White, who scored 27 points (with six 3-pointers), and Jaylen Brown, who added 33 points and 10 rebounds.

  • Role-players like Payton Pritchard came through: he contributed 16 points and sank two clutch free-throws in the final 2.4 seconds to seal the win.

This game underscores why “Pistons vs Celtics” remains one of the most compelling match-ups in the league: high-stakes, star performances, and crunch-time drama.

Pistons vs Celtics: Recent Timeline & Match Stats

Date Result Key Highlights
Nov 26, 2025 Celtics 117 — Pistons 114 Celtics end Pistons’ 13-game streak; Cunningham drops 42, White and Brown deliver clutch scoring.
Oct 26, 2025 Pistons 119 — Celtics 113 Pistons bounce back — Cunningham scores 25, Jalen Duren adds firepower to secure the win.
Feb 27, 2025 Pistons 117 — Celtics 97 Balanced Pistons attack (Cunningham + Beasley) crush Celtics in dominant win.

These games paint a picture of a dynamic rivalry — it can swing either way depending on momentum, execution, and timely contributions.
